I have installed the speed cameras onto my go300 sucsesfully, 2 questions I have

1. It defaults at 273 yards for the warning, is 273 too much or not enough, would like to know a good distance. I travel on motorways between 70 and 80.

2.I have ticked only warn when cameras on route, is it best I unticked.

The general consensus seems to be about 200yds for 30mph Gatso, going up to about 400yds for a 70mph.

Mobiles, I usually double that figure as they have a greater range and they can 'see' you before you see them.

Personally, again, I leave it unticked so that I am aware of cameras on the other side of the dual carriageway, and can 'be prepared' on the way back. Smile
